Typographic hierarchy
Paper title: 12 pts., capital letters and bold.
Subtitle 1: 11 pts., capital and small letters (only the first letter of each word with capital letter) bold.
Subtitle 2: 10 pts., capital and small letters, bold.
Subtitle 3: 10 pts., capital and small letters
Author, institution and e-mail: 9 pts.
Abstract: 10 pts., italics.
Classification JEL and key words: 8 pts.
Text of the article: 10 pts.
Foot note: 7 pts. In arabic numbers.
Bibliographical references:
- Author: capital and small letters, bold, Arial 8
- Article: capital and small letters, within “”, Times New Roman 8
- Work: capital and small letters, italics
- Editorial, year, pages: capital and small letters
